#6e071b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6e071b is composed of 43.1% red, 2.7% green and 10.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93.6% magenta, 75.5% yellow and 56.9% black. It has a hue angle of 348.3 degrees, a saturation of 88% and a lightness of 22.9%. #6e071b color hex could be obtained by blending #dc0e36 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

Shades and Tints of #6e071b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120104 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6e071b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3d3939 is the less saturated color, while #730218 is the most saturated one.
